The cheapest way to travel from Ghent to Luxembourg is a train with an average price of $25 (€20).

This is compared to other travel options from Ghent to Luxembourg:

A train is $22 (€18) less than a bus for this route with tickets for a bus from Ghent to Luxembourg costing on average $46 (€38).

A train is $252 (€206) less than a flight for this route with tickets for a flight from Ghent to Luxembourg costing on average $277 (€226).

The fastest way to travel from Ghent to Luxembourg is by bus with an average journey time of 3h 58m.

Other travel options to Luxembourg take longer:

Train takes on average 4h 30m.

Flight takes on average 7h 0m.

The distance from Ghent to Luxembourg is approximately 145 miles (234 km).
The average frequency per day from Ghent to Luxembourg is:
  • Around 13 flights per day.
  • Around 7 trains per day.
  • Around 3 buses per day.

However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your route between Ghent and Luxembourg as scheduled services by train, bus, and flight can vary by season or day of the week.

These are the most popular departure and arrival points from Ghent to Luxembourg:
  • Flights mostly depart from Brussels Airport and arrive in Luxembourg Airport.
  • Trains mostly depart from Ghent St Pieters and arrive in Luxembourg station.
  • Buses mostly depart from Gent, Ghent and arrive in Luxembourg, P+R Bouillon.

Most travelers need at least three days in Luxembourg to see the main sights at a comfortable pace. If you want day trips or a slower itinerary, consider adding extra time.
In Luxembourg, you can explore the Bock Casemates, discover the National Museum of History and Art, and relax in Pétrusse Valley Park. Pay respects at the Luxembourg American Cemetery Memorial and enjoy a boat ride on the Moselle River. Visit Vianden Castle, Luxembourg City Old Quarters, the Grand Ducal Palace, Mudam Luxembourg, and Notre-Dame Cathedral for a mix of history, art, and stunning architecture.
To explore Luxembourg's main attractions, 2 to 3 days are typically sufficient. This allows time to visit the capital's historic sites, museums, and the scenic countryside.
